Shortly thereafter, eddie stone wrote the biography donald writes no more, which encapsulated the deterministic factors that contributed to goiness tragic life, outlining issues related to class, race, addiction and the cyclical systemic issues of the biased judicial process. Goiness narratives offer a painfully vivid account of the black underworld, where cadillacs, crooked cops and dilapidated buildings abound and whores, corner hustlers, pushers and thieves thrive. Born in detroit, michigan, donald goines 19361974 was an africanamerican writer of urban fiction.
